Skip to content

Instantly share code, notes, and snippets.

@valery-zhurbenko
Created April 24, 2020 19:07
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save valery-zhurbenko/c2eb1226529c868fe954931c5ad4d481 to your computer and use it in GitHub Desktop.
Save valery-zhurbenko/c2eb1226529c868fe954931c5ad4d481 to your computer and use it in GitHub Desktop.
data "terraform_remote_state" "mainoutput" {
backend = "remote"
config = {
organization = "${trimsuffix("${var.TFC_WORKSPACE_SLUG}", "/${var.TFC_WORKSPACE_NAME}")}"
workspaces = {
name = "${trimsuffix("${var.TFC_WORKSPACE_NAME}", "-helm")}"
}
}
}
variable "TFC_WORKSPACE_NAME" {}
variable "TFC_WORKSPACE_SLUG" {}
### Use "output" to verify yourself ;-)
output "workspace" {
value = "${trimsuffix("${var.TFC_WORKSPACE_NAME}", "-helm")}"
}
output "tfe-org" {
value = "${trimsuffix("${var.TFC_WORKSPACE_SLUG}", "/${var.TFC_WORKSPACE_NAME}")}"
}
output "remote_workspace_output" {
value = "${data.terraform_remote_state.mainoutput.output}"
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ment